As a Senior Associate or Director in our Finance Legal team, based in Melbourne or Sydney, your impact will be seen by:
Delivering legal services in a uniquely integrated environment, working closely with non-legal colleagues in Debt & Capital Advisory, Tax, Private Clients, Deals, Assurance and other non-legal lines of service
Advising on a broad range of financing transactions, including market-leading large-scale private equity and corporate acquisitions, renewables, energy and infrastructure projects, and a range of real estate matters, including socially critical community housing developments
Developing deep client relationships, leveraging PwC’s broader market presence and a real opportunity to engage with clients on strategic matters beyond the role of traditional lawyers, often at or before deal inception
Providing commercial solutions to clients’ complex and diverse funding requirements and challenges
About you
You have a top-tier background in banking and finance law, ideally with 4 – 9 years’ PQE and are skilled in large scale corporate finance and one or more of project finance, acquisition and leveraged finance, property finance, structured and asset finance and debt capital markets. You will also hold an understanding of transaction management, a commercial mindset and a genuine desire to be part of a growing practice.
